Anyone else get this - did you find it was worse or improved in pregnancy? I've suffered with it for a couple of years and have managed in the summer with sunscreens and steroid cream/antihistamines to manage flare ups. However at 8 weeks pregnant I can't take the tablets or cream, but I want to be able to head outside in the summer! Anyone have any tips? :)

Sympathy Lexi. Mine was worse during pregnancy - I also had a cold type allergy too and came out in really bad hives on areas exposed to the cold. It was joyous.

I think all you can do is cover-up really and take it very slowly with your initial exposure. Which sunscreen do you use? I use Boots Soltan as it has 5 star UVA protection and find that this is the only one I can safely use.
